Snowflake Ocellaris Clownfish

Amphiprion ocellaris

Snowflakes are a popular variant of A. ocellaris that have a considerable amount of irregular white markings on the body. The edges of the white coloration will typically be jagged and angular.

Each Snowflake is evaluated by an experienced grader for the percentage of white and the attractiveness of the striping. Just as their name implies – no two are alike.

This popular clownfish was originally produced by Tropical Marine Centre in the UK around 1999.  At that time extra white patterning was considered an undesirable trait.  TMC had two, completely normal-looking pairs of Ocellaris that produced two or three snowflakes once every couple of spawns.  These pairs are still alive and reproducing today but they no longer produce Snowflakes.  Only around 100 of these fish were ever exported to the United States making F1 Broodstock direct from TMC extremely rare.  ORA obtained its first pair of F1 Snowflakes in 2005 and they have been working on developing a hardier and more colourful strain of this beautiful clownfish ever since.

Acclimation

Temperature Match

Place the sealed bag containing the fish or invertebrate into your tank. Allow it to float for 15-20 minutes to gradually equalize the temperature between the bag and your aquarium. This step minimizes stress caused by sudden temperature changes.

Drip Acclimation

Set up a drip acclimation system by using airline tubing. Start a slow siphon from your tank into the bag or bucket containing the fish or invertebrate, allowing water to drip slowly. Acclimate over a period of approximately 30 minutes, gradually increasing the volume of tank water to match salinity and other water parameters.

Check Salinity

Use a refractometer to measure the salinity in the bag or acclimation container. Ensure the salinity matches your tank’s salinity before transferring the fish or invertebrate. Matching salinity helps reduce stress and prevents shock when introducing new animals.

Release Fish/Invert

Gently transfer the fish or invertebrate into the tank, avoiding netting them if possible to reduce physical stress. Allow the animal to swim out on its own if transferring from a container. Discard the acclimation water, as it may contain contaminants.
